We've got Hannes (1971)

Title in Estonian: Meile tuli Hannes

Documentary Duration 09:23

Documentary focuses on the birth of Hannes Martjak in the collective farm called May 9th in Paide district, Estonia. Registering his name in Väätsa culture house. The documentary shows episodes about the namegiving party and the surroundings of the home where the baby Hannes lives – residential buildings, construction work, grain harvesting, work in the cowshed, tractor harvesting the dry hay in the field, making ensilage. The film also depicts Hannes' parents Ene and Villem Martjak, Endel Lieberg - head of the collective farm.

Director: Vitali Gorbunov
